ALLEY (contrary to regulations), Jamaica postmark
(CDS) dated JU 29 88 on horiz. pair QV ½d (SG.16) fragment CONTRARY TO REGULATIONS as the "A78" had sole duty as adhesive "killer" at this time.
The Vere Post Office was re-named Alley in 1875 and continued to use the "A78" obliterator as an adhesive "killer" until at least 1893.
